About the Role
Expedia Group's Integrated Marketing and Creative team is seeking a Senior B2B Creative Project Manager to manage creative workflow, operational excellence, project management, forecasting, and resource allocation. This role involves developing innovative global marketing strategies and ensuring the flawless execution of B2B creative projects.
Responsibilities
- Steward day-to-day project management of multiple brand design projects, serving as primary point of contact with creatives, business partners, stakeholders and leaders.
- Work with business partners and stakeholders to ensure accurate briefs are provided, digging in to understand the creative team’s ask within each brief.
- Build project workback schedules for each of your projects and share with the appropriate creative team, business partners and stakeholders.
- Anticipate and manage potential blockers across concept development, production, and delivery phases; flag to appropriate partners and proactively find solutions.
- Maintain detailed, clear, and proactive organization of your projects in project management software (Jira, Smartsheet, etc.), be the driving force to ensure creative is approved and delivered on time.
- Set up and lead project kick-off meetings, creative review meetings, and leadership review meetings; take and distribute detailed notes and action items in a timely manner.
- Operate with a sense of urgency and proactiveness to ensure work is completed according to deadlines.
- Maintain a high level of attention to detail, reviewing all work to ensure legal compliance and accuracy across all creative updates and revisions.
- Manage localization and relevant trackers to ensure creative is versioned properly.
- Partner with business leaders to develop annual and quarterly forecasting and resource planning, incorporating AI-owned, contracted, and FTE capacity into resourcing models.
- Manage project intake for your line of business, assessing resourcing and prioritization needs.
- Report regularly on team capacity and utilization to support proactive resourcing and prioritization calls with business leaders.
- Maintain a real-time view of team capacity and workload across creatives and freelancers, flagging over- or under-allocation to inform resourcing decisions.
- Architect creative workflow processes and agentic tools, partnering with Creative Tech to build repeatable AI-enabled workflows that drive efficiency for the PM function and Creative team.
- Triage and route project intake across human, hybrid, and AI-enabled production paths based on repeatability, timeline, and brand risk.
- Establish and maintain RACI for projects involving AI-assisted production, ensuring clear ownership across creative, Creative Tech, and business stakeholders.
- Define and enforce human-in-the-loop QA checkpoints for AI-generated or AI-assisted creative before it reaches stakeholder or legal review.
- Own naming conventions, asset taxonomy, and DAM hygiene to support AI-enabled versioning, reuse, and performance measurement.
- Support creative team enablement on new AI tools and workflows — documentation, training sessions, and troubleshooting first-line support.
